Lightning can reach temperatures around 30,000 oC whereas the surface temperature of the Sun is only about 5,500 oC.

However the corona can reach temperatures of around 3,000,000 oC while the core is over 15,000,000 oC

How can heat be produced by bolt lighting?

a flash can heat the air around it to temperatures five times hotter than the sun's surface. This heat causes surrounding air to rapidly expand and vibrate, which creates the pealing thunder we hear a short time after seeing a lightning flash

Why does the sun feel hotter at higher elevations?

The sun feels hotter at higher elevations because the air is thinner, which means there are fewer molecules to absorb and scatter the sun's heat. This results in more direct sunlight reaching the surface, making it feel hotter.


Is the sun or lightning hotter?

The surface of the sun has an estimated temperature of around 10,000 degrees Fahrenheit, while lightning can reach temperatures of about 54,000 degrees Fahrenheit in a split second. So, lightning is hotter than the surface of the sun for that brief moment.

Is the sun hotter in the middle or the outside of the sun?

The sun's core is hotter than its outer layers. The core of the sun reaches temperatures of around 15 million degrees Celsius, while the outer layers are cooler, with temperatures around 5,500 degrees Celsius.
